Understanding Project Management
Project management is the process of planning, organizing, motivating, and controlling the use of resources to achieve specific goals within a defined timeframe and budget. A successful project not only meets requirements for scope, quality, and time, but also fulfills the expectations of stakeholders.
Key Stages in Project Management
1. Initiation:
This stage focuses on defining project objectives, scope, and feasibility. Detailed planning, budget allocation, and resource allocation are crucial.
2. Planning:
This involves creating a detailed plan including task assignments, timelines, budgeting, risk management, and communication plans.
3. Execution:
This stage focuses on implementing the established plan. Managers monitor progress, solve problems, and adjust the plan as needed. Effective communication is key to success at this stage.
4. Monitoring & Controlling:
Continuously monitor the project’s progress, costs, and quality to ensure everything is on track. Control risks and adjust the plan to achieve the objectives.
5. Closure:
After project completion, this stage focuses on summarizing, evaluating results, drawing lessons learned, and preparing a final report. Evaluating project effectiveness provides valuable lessons for future projects.
Popular Project Management Methodologies
Various project management methodologies exist, each suitable for different project types and scales. Popular methodologies include: Agile, Waterfall, Scrum, Kanban. Choosing the right methodology is crucial for project success.
Risk Management in Projects
Risk management is an integral part of project management. Identifying, assessing, and planning responses to potential risks helps mitigate negative impacts on the project.
Project Management Tools
Many software tools support project management, aiding in managing progress, costs, resources, and effective communication. Popular tools include: Asana, Trello, Jira, Monday.com.
Conclusion
Project management is a complex but crucial process. Applying effective management principles and methodologies increases the likelihood of completing projects on time, within budget, and to the required quality, leading to business success.
